Frontline - “News War: Secret, Sources & Spin (Part 2)”. The second hour in a four part Frontline series that deals with how political, cultural, legal, and economic forces are affecting the role of the press in our society. This part deals with the legal predicaments reporters face when informing the public about the war on terror (at what point is their discussing it helpful to the terrorists and therefore jailable).

The March of the Bonus Army. Yes, this does sound a little like a videogame, turns out it’s nowhere near as happy as that. It’s all about thousands of unemployed World War I vets marching to the Capital during the Great Depression. The government and military response to them may have been overly harsh. Watch this and judge for yourself.
